GENERAL DESCRIPTION:


Under general supervision, the Building Operator is responsible for the inspection, operation, and maintenance coordination of building/facility related systems. This includes, but is not limited to, boilers, HVAC and other mechanical, electrical, plumbing, and carpentry related components within various facilities/buildings. These responsibilities are completed by visual observation, using hand and power tools, and by coordinating the resources (materials/contractors/ trades) necessary to complete the task. The position exercises considerable degree of independent judgement although the work is subject to inspection.


RESPONSIBILITIES:


  • Inspect, monitor, operate, and perform minor maintenance of heating plants within the 5th class designation.
  • Keep records related to the operation of heating plants in accordance with provincial requirements and all related codes.
  • Perform administrative work including completion of work orders, updating operating conditions, and document maintenance.
  • Report any major maintenance/repair items to supervisor.
  • Troubleshoot HVAC system, plumbing and electrical problems, and carpentry/furniture deterioration.
  • Perform a variety of maintenance work in municipal buildings including, but not limited to, replacing light bulbs, adjusting doors, fixing carpet, adjusting furniture, and hanging pictures.
  • Notify of any necessary trade requirements and assist tradespersons in the repair and maintenance of specialized trade related activities.
  • Identify general maintenance, clean up, and snow removal requirements and request assistance where necessary.
  • Meet and escort contractors and other staff within municipal facilities as required.
  • Perform regular facility inspections and audits to ensure code compliance, facility sustainment, and occupant comfort.
  • Perform other related duties as required.

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:


  • High School Diploma or GED equivalent is required.
  • Fifth (5th) Class Power Engineering Certificate recognized by the Alberta Boiler Association is required.
  • Fourth (4th) Class Power Engineering Certificate recognized by the Alberta Boiler Association is an asset.
  • Five (5) years of experience in the inspection, operation, and maintenance of facilities and buildings, which includes two (2) years of experience as a Building Operator, is required.
